2. Walking in Van Gogh’s Footsteps
Arles, to tell the truth, held this special area in the existence of Vincent van Gogh. Indeed, that man lived here for simply over a year, yet during that period he created more than 200 paintings, as well as the “Starry Night Over the Rhône” and “Café Terrace at Night”. 3. Visiting the Roman Amphitheatre and Theatre
Arles’ Roman background is seriously, one of its defining features. So, for real, the Arles Amphitheatre and the Antique Theatre are those spectacular, breathtaking, points of interest. Initially, for example, these structures, being as they were, that much were given people together, or rather held people, numbering thousands for performances and games. As of now, basically, they stand as impressive reminders, in a manner of speaking, to that Roman influence in the region.
The Arles Amphitheatre, also known as the arena, once housed, very, those violent, exciting gladiatorial fights and animal hunts. At present, basically, you can walk through its arches and stand in the very middle where each action would, often, unfold. Check out a guided tour, even if you are that type. You can find information and facts, basically, about its record and design.
A quick stroll away will get you to the Antique Theatre. The old theatre, once that setting to set plays and performances, still hosts shows today, so to speak.
